From the bench: Of professional responsibility

Times of Malta 

According to local law, specifi­cally the Notarial Profession and Notarial Archives Act, notaries are public officers. They are charged to receive acts inter vivos and wills, and to attribute public faith thereto. Notaries are empowered to draft private writings containing agreements that purport to create legal rights and obligations between third parties. Teenager seriously injured in Binġemma fall

Times of Malta 

A 17-year old man was seriously injured on Saturday after falling from a height in Binġemma valley, in the limits of Mġarr. The young man, a Birkirkara resident, was assisted by the Civil Protection Department and medical personnel on site after the incident at around 11.30am.  He was then transferred to Mater Dei Hospital for further treatment.  Police investigations are ongoing.

Six new COVID-19 cases and no deaths reported

Times of Malta 

The number of new COVID-19 cases reported in Malta continued to hit months-long lows on Saturday, when just six new virus cases were reported. No patients died overnight, meaning the death toll remained stable at 417. The six cases detected are the lowest daily tally since July 27, 2020 – more than nine months ago. As of Saturday, Malta had 247 active virus cases.  Healthcare workers administered 2,022 swab tests on Friday, the Health Ministry data indicated.
